  9. Aw thanks Androo Although your right, too many ppl are doing it now Gotta be careful with what guards you buy, cos the conversion guards I bought don't fit due to them being GTT ones. I had it all stripped down today for the new front to go on and had to put the 33 front back on again So it'll be done in the next week or so when when the new guards come. Matt - you can't just put a R34 bonnet on a R33 they're completely different. You gotta buy conversion guards, R34 bonnet, R34 headlights and R34 front bar. Then to fit it there has to be custom brackets made up for the new headlights and a bit of modification to your support bar so it all fits flush... bit of mucking around and lots of $$$
